The Nokia C2-01 features a 2.0-inch TFT screen with a 240x320 pixels resolution (QVGA). When searching for games, always look for the "240x320" tag to ensure the user interface fits your screen perfectly.

Asphalt 6: AdrenalineAsphalt is the gold standard for mobile racing. In the Nokia C2-01 version, you get to drive licensed cars through neon-lit cities. The sense of speed is incredible for a Java game, and the "Adrenaline" boost mode adds a layer of intensity that most feature phone games lack.

While the smartphone version was a 3D first-person shooter, the Java version transformed N.O.V.A. into an intense, futuristic 2D side-scrolling shooter with giant mechs, alien enemies, and sci-fi weaponry.
Games must be downloaded in .JAR (Java Archive) format. Sometimes a companion .JAD file is provided to help the phone install the data.
